Powering the Future: Transportation Battery Market Outlook

The global shift toward electrification has transformed the transportation sector, placing high-performance energy storage at the center of modern mobility. According to recent market analysis, the Transportation Battery Market is poised for significant expansion, expected to reach US$ 340.16 billion by 2034 from US$ 110.04 billion in 2025, growing at a robust CAGR of 13.36% between 2026 and 2034.

This growth is fueled by the aggressive global transition toward electric vehicles (EVs), the electrification of heavy-duty commercial fleets, and a relentless drive toward decarbonizing public transportation systems worldwide.

Industry Overview: The Engine of Electrification

Transportation batteries—spanning lithium-ion, lead-acid, and emerging chemistries like sodium-ion and solid-state—serve as the heart of modern electric and hybrid vehicles. As automakers retire internal combustion engine (ICE) programs, the demand for batteries that offer higher energy density, improved safety, and faster charging cycles has become the primary benchmark for competitive success.

Beyond passenger cars, the industry is witnessing a surge in battery demand for buses, long-haul trucks, and specialized logistics fleets. With continuous innovation in battery chemistry, these energy storage systems are no longer just components; they are the critical infrastructure enabling a sustainable, low-emission future.

Core Growth Drivers

Several strategic factors are propelling the market forward:

  • Technological Innovation: Breakthroughs in silicon-anode lithium-ion batteries and solid-state technology are effectively extending driving ranges and reducing charging times. For instance, recent developments in superfast charging systems, such as those providing an 800-kilometer range, are mitigating "range anxiety" among consumers.

  • Commercial Fleet Electrification: Logistics companies and public transport operators are shifting to electric platforms to optimize fuel costs and meet strict emissions mandates.

  • High-Energy Density Solutions: As the demand for longer driving ranges grows, the development of high-capacity cells (such as 450 Wh/kg lithium-ion batteries) is becoming a standard for next-generation electric mobility.

  • Governmental Support: Subsidies, tax incentives, and investments in domestic battery manufacturing (particularly in the US, China, and Germany) are creating a stable ecosystem for long-term growth.

Critical Challenges: Supply Chains and Sustainability

While the market outlook is overwhelmingly positive, stakeholders must address systemic hurdles:

  • Raw Material Volatility: Dependence on critical minerals like lithium, cobalt, and nickel exposes the industry to supply chain risks and geopolitical tensions. The industry is currently pivoting toward alternative chemistries, such as sodium-ion and LFP, to diversify supply chains.

  • Infrastructure Gaps: The transition to electric mobility is often outpaced by the deployment of charging networks. Ensuring widespread access to fast-charging stations remains vital for mass market adoption.

  • Recycling and End-of-Life: As the first generation of large-scale EV batteries reaches its life limit, the industry faces the challenge of scaling circular economy processes. Advanced recycling facilities are required to reclaim precious metals and reduce environmental impact.

Regional Market Analysis

China: The Global Manufacturing Hub

China maintains its position as the largest market globally. With immense manufacturing capacity and state-sponsored integration across the battery value chain, Chinese firms are driving innovation in both lithium-ion and dual-power architectures, supplying the global automotive market with cost-competitive solutions.

United States: Scaling Domestic Production

The U.S. is rapidly expanding its footprint through aggressive incentives for domestic cell production. The commercialization of high-energy battery cells (300 Wh/kg and above) is signaling a move toward high-performance domestic manufacturing to power an evolving fleet of passenger and commercial EVs.

Germany: Engineering Excellence

Germany remains the bedrock of European battery innovation. Automakers like BMW are at the forefront of implementing advanced drive concepts, such as 800-volt architectures, which are designed to push the boundaries of charging speed and thermal efficiency.

Saudi Arabia: Emerging Mobility Ecosystem

As part of the Vision 2030 initiatives, Saudi Arabia is actively building the infrastructure for local EV assembly and battery ecosystem development, aiming to become a regional leader in electric urban mobility.

Market Segmentation: A Diverse Landscape

Segment Highlights
Battery Type Lead-Acid (Reliability/Cost), Lithium-Ion (Market Leader), Solid-State (Future Growth)
Vehicle Type Passenger Cars, Commercial Vehicles, Buses, Rail Systems
Drive Type Electric Vehicles (EV), Hybrid Vehicles (HEV)

While lithium-ion batteries currently dominate the landscape due to their proven density and reliability, the lead-acid sector remains essential for start-stop systems and conventional automotive applications, particularly in emerging markets where affordability is a priority.
